About this dish

Plump king prawns briefly marinated in tikka spices, flash-cooked until pink, then stirred into a luscious tomato and cream masala. Ready in under 30 minutes from start to finish.

Method

1

Finely dice the onion, mince the garlic cloves, and finely grate the ginger. Pat the prawns dry with kitchen paper and set everything aside.

Approx. 5 minutes
2

In a bowl, combine the yogurt, 0.5 tsp Kashmiri chilli powder, 0.5 tsp garam masala, turmeric, cumin, lemon juice, and 0.25 tsp salt. Add the prawns, toss to coat, and leave to marinate at room temperature.

Approx. 10 minutes
3

Melt the ghee and vegetable oil in a large frying pan over medium heat. Add the diced onion and cook, stirring occasionally, until soft and golden.

Approx. 10 minutes
4

Add the minced garlic and grated ginger. Cook, stirring constantly, until fragrant.

Approx. 2 minutes
5

Stir in the tomato purée and cook, stirring, until darkened in colour.

Approx. 1 minutes
6

Add the chopped tomatoes, ground coriander, 0.5 tsp garam masala, and 0.5 tsp Kashmiri chilli powder. Simmer, stirring occasionally, until the sauce thickens and the oil begins to separate.

Approx. 10 minutes
7

Stir in the double cream and sugar. Season with salt to taste and bring back to a gentle simmer.

Approx. 1 minutes
8

Add the marinated prawns to the sauce. Cook gently, stirring, until the prawns are pink, opaque, and curled — the internal temperature should reach 63°C (145°F) on a digital thermometer. Do not overcook or they will turn rubbery.

Approx. 4 minutes
9

Rub the kasuri methi between your palms to release its aroma and stir into the sauce. Cook briefly to infuse.

Approx. 1 minutes
10

Remove from heat and serve immediately, garnished with fresh coriander.

Approx. 1 minutes
